Responsibilities

  • Deploy and support enterprise storage platforms (Pure Storage, HPE, NetApp) and SDS solutions (Ceph, Longhorn).
  • Implement and manage backup solutions (preferably Rubik).
  • Build and maintain Infrastructure-as-Code for storage platforms using Ansible, Terraform, Helm and Git, with Python/Bash automation.
  • Implement CI/CD pipelines for infrastructure updates, patching, upgrades, testing, and rollback.
  • Perform deep troubleshooting across storage, Kubernetes, hypervisors, networking, and Linux systems.
  • Develop and maintain technical documentation, architecture diagrams, operational procedures, and runbooks
  • Collaborate globally on change management, documentation, and operational best practices.

Requirements

  • 6+ years of experience managing enterprise storage and Kubernetes platforms on Linux.
  • Strong hands-on experience with SDS solutions (Ceph, Longhorn) and storage migrations from legacy systems.
  • Expertise with block, file, and object storage, including Fibre Channel (Cisco MDS) and IP-based protocols (NVMe-oF or iSCSI farbics).
  • Expert knowledge of Kubernetes and Linux systems (Ubuntu, RHEL/CentOS).
  • Proficiency with Infrastructure-as-Code (IaC) (Ansible, Terraform) for provisioning storage and backup schedules
  • Expertise in backup technologies (preferably Rubik)
  • Experience operating 24x7 mission-critical production environments.
  • Hands-on experience with KVM hypervisors (Suse Harvester, OpenStack).
  • Proficiency with Git, CI/CD pipelines, and automated testing frameworks
  • Ability to write technical documentation and contribute to community wikis or knowledge bases.
